#4137: 錯在哪??


allenbody (pi)

學校 : 國立彰化師範大學
編號 : 12849
來源 : [140.113.241.189]
最後登入時間 :
2011-05-27 12:24:10
b186. 97七區資訊學科1(改編) -- 97學年度彰雲嘉區資訊學科能力競賽 | From: [124.11.225.254] | 發表日期 : 2010-08-21 15:09

#include <iostream>
using namespace std;

int main()
{
    long long int cho, cake, cook;
    while(cin>>cook>>cho>>cake)
    {
          if(cook >= 10 && cake >= 2)
                  cho++;
         
          cout<<cook<<" 個餅乾,"<<cho<<" 盒巧克力,"<<cake<<" 個蛋糕。"<<endl;
    }
    return 0;
}

與正確輸出不相符(line:2)
您的答案為: 2147483647 個餅乾,3 盒巧克力,2147483647 個蛋糕。
正確答案為: 2147483647 個餅乾,214748366 盒巧克力,2147483647 個蛋糕。

不知錯在哪??

 
#4396: Re:錯在哪??


e157945 (慢慢來~)

學校 : 正修科技大學
編號 : 13446
來源 : [118.171.2.227]
最後登入時間 :
2012-01-25 19:41:37
b186. 97七區資訊學科1(改編) -- 97學年度彰雲嘉區資訊學科能力競賽 | From: [219.85.94.177] | 發表日期 : 2010-10-15 17:28

#include
using namespace std;

int main()
{
    long long int cho, cake, cook;
    while(cin>>cook>>cho>>cake)
    {
          if(cook >= 10 && cake >= 2)
                  cho++;
         
          cout<<<" 個餅乾,"<<<" 盒巧克力,"<<<" 個蛋糕。"<
    }
    return 0;
}

與正確輸出不相符(line:2)
您的答案為: 2147483647 個餅乾,3 盒巧克力,2147483647 個蛋糕。
正確答案為: 2147483647 個餅乾,214748366 盒巧克力,2147483647 個蛋糕。

不知錯在哪??

題目說買10個餅乾和2個蛋糕就送一盒巧克力,

那我如果買了100個餅乾和20個蛋糕的話,應該要送幾盒巧克力呢?

就照這邏輯下去寫程式就可以AC了!!

 
ZeroJudge Forum